JavaPro Systems is a​ start-up company that makes connectors for​ high-speed Internet connections. JavaPro Systems has budgeted
Iteru [2.4K]

Answer:

$429.60 Favorable

Explanation:

Provided information,

Standard Hours for each product = 3 hours

Standard Cost per hour = $14.00

Actual hours used = 198

Actual output = 80 connectors

Standard hours for actual output = 80 \times 3 = 240 hours

Actual Rate = $14.80 per hour

Direct labor cost variance = Standard Cost - Actual Cost

Standard Cost = Standard hours \times Standard Rae

= 240 \times $14 = $3,360

Actual Cost = 198 \times $14.80 = $2,930.40

Variance = $3,360 - $2,930.40 = $429.60

Since actual cost is less than standard variance is favorable.

$429.60 Favorable
